If you are into ibutton then you might take a look at the tini from Maxim-Dallas, they have an interesting application note that seems to fit your requirements and as you are already planning on running cat5 then the wiring should already be there. http://www.maxim-ic.com/appnotes.cfm/appnote_number/609 http://www.maxim-ic.com/appnotes.cfm/appnote_number/3266 They also have a number of notes on networked switches using the same microcontroller, http://www.maxim-ic.com/appnotes.cfm/appnote_number/2036 I have not used these but I have a number of 1-wire sensors about the house.
